Pregnancy Acne: What You Can Do

Marcie Jones Leave a Comment

Pregnancy hormones cause better circulation and more fluid to skin cells, and that’s what gives a lot of pregnant women that glowing, slightly flushed look. Pregnancy Mask: What Can You Do?

Marcie Jones Leave a Comment

how can i get rid of my pregnancy mask?” The mask of pregnancy, also known as melasma or chloasma, is brown or grayish patches on your face caused by melanin-producing cells in skin being stimulated by the hormones estrogen and progesterone.
